Make sure your DVD drive is correctly connected Before you do anything else, check again that your DVD drive is properly connected to the computer.

If the problem still exists after confirmation, you can move to next method. Updates Windows 10 to the newest version If you find DVD not detected in Windows 10 right after a system upgrade, this issue is very likely to be fixed in the next update. Steps: 1. Reinstall the DVD drive Device reinstallation can sometimes solve the problem.

Just perform it in Device Manager. Restart your PC. Windows 10 shall reinstall the DVD drive automatically after booting.
